From e7abd100c45fe57426f6fe37b00a075c66e86287 Mon Sep 17 00:00:00 2001
From: Alberto Bertogli <albertito@blitiri.com.ar>
Date: Wed, 25 Feb 2009 04:32:37 -0200
Subject: [PATCH 18/31] Replace malloc() + strcpy() with strdup()

Signed-off-by: Alberto Bertogli <albertito@blitiri.com.ar>
---
 check.c |    3 +--
 1 files changed, 1 insertions(+), 2 deletions(-)

diff --git a/check.c b/check.c
index b5b095c..251d6a1 100644
--- a/check.c
+++ b/check.c
@@ -147,12 +147,11 @@ int jfsck(const char *name, const char *jdir, struct jfsck_result *res)
 			goto exit;
 		}
 	} else {
-		fs.jdir = (char *) malloc(strlen(jdir) + 1);
+		fs.jdir = strdup(jdir);
 		if (fs.jdir == NULL) {
 			ret = J_ENOMEM;
 			goto exit;
 		}
-		strcpy(fs.jdir, jdir);
 	}
 
 	rv = lstat(fs.jdir, &sinfo);
-- 
1.6.2.rc0.226.gf08f

